About 6-thiophen-2-yl-1H-1,3,5-triazin-2-one

6-thiophen-2-yl-1H-1,3,5-triazin-2-one (PubChem CID 138461120) has the molecular formula C7H5N3OS and a molecular weight of 179.20 g/mol. Its IUPAC name is 6-thiophen-2-yl-1H-1,3,5-triazin-2-one.
